The hexadecimal color code #B8CEE2 corresponds to the code RGB( 184, 206, 226 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,72 level), green (at 0,81 level) and blue (at 0,89 level). Its brightness is 80% and its saturation is 42%. It is composed of red at 29%, green at 33% and blue at 36%.

Color Palettes

The complementary color #47311D is the color exactly opposite to #B8CEE2 on the color wheel. The triadic palette is created by selecting two colors that are evenly spaced on the color wheel.

Uses of #B8CEE2 in CSS

When using #B8CEE2 as the background color, consider selecting a darker text color for improved readability. If you want to use #B8CEE2 as the text color, prefer a dark background, such as Black.
